When considering a treadmill for home use, it is necessary to understand the various types readily available on the market:

Manual Treadmills: These [treadmills Sales](https://buzzinguniverse.com/members/creamlizard5/activity/478293/) are powered by the user's motion rather than an electric motor. They tend to be more cost effective and compact.

Electric Treadmills: These are the most typical type, including an electric motor for smooth operation. They typically include a range of programs and functions.

Folding Treadmills: Ideal for those with restricted space, folding treadmills can be quickly stored after usage, making them perfect for little homes.

Commercial-Grade Treadmills: Typically discovered in health clubs, these are heavy-duty treadmills developed for high usage. They may not be essential for many home users however are an alternative for severe athletes.

When picking a treadmill, specific functions can significantly affect the total user experience and efficiency of the machine:

Motor Power: Measured in horsepower (HP), a more effective motor will offer smoother operation, particularly for users who prepare on running rather than walking.

Running Surface: The size of the deck should accommodate the user's stride. Standard treadmill decks are generally 48 to 55 inches long.

Incline Options: An adjustable incline can improve exercise strength, simulating hill running and enabling different workout.

Console Display: Look for easy to use consoles that display screen necessary metrics like speed, distance, calories burned, and heart rate.

Cushioning System: A great cushioning system helps reduce the influence on joints, enabling a more comfortable workout.

Connection Features: Many modern-day treadmills featured Bluetooth connection, enabling users to sync their gadgets, listen to music, or follow workout programs through apps.
Upkeep and Care of Treadmills
Appropriate maintenance is essential for making sure a treadmill's longevity. Here are some pointers:

Regular Cleaning: Dust, dirt, and sweat can build up on the machine and affect its performance. Use a soft, wet fabric to clean the surface and check the belt frequently.

Lubrication: The treadmill belt must be lubed according to the maker's guidelines, normally every three to six months, to guarantee smooth operation.

Evaluation of Components: Periodically check nuts, bolts, and screws to ensure they are tight, and check the power cord for any signs of wear.

Proper Usage: Users should comply with the weight limit offered by the producer to avoid damaging the machine.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Which treadmill is best for newbies?
Novices may discover manual or fundamental electric treadmills with less complex includes easier to use. It's suggested to select machines with uncomplicated functions to avoid confusion.
2. Just how much space do I require for a treadmill?
Ideally, a treadmill should be put in an area that allows for at least 3 feet of clearance behind the machine and a number of feet on either side to allow safe use.
3. Are foldable treadmills long lasting?
While numerous foldable models are long lasting, it's essential to examine the requirements and user reviews to make sure the model can withstand extensive use.
